This limited edition reel has been produced to commemorate
the life of the late James Leighton Hardy, for whom the JLH reel was named.
The JLH Reel: The JLH reel was introduced in 1991,
the year before Jim retired and was a piece of classic design that reflected
the exacting standards of its namesake.
The original
range comprised six reels, ranging from a diminutive 2 7/8” trout model to a
mighty 4” salmon reel and it was one of the first reels that Hardy manufactured
from bar-stock alloy, which made it possible to built light, but incredibly
strong components which were perfectly matched to carbon fibre rods.
The 1991 reel
was the natural successor to the Lightweight range, built since 1936, and it
brought the concept up-to-date with an exposed rim, optional left or right-hand
wind, and a reversible nickel-silver line guard. The range was so popular that
it was updated several times, the most significant modifications being the
introduction of a powerful disc drag in 2000 and a large arbour range in 2003.
The JLH
Click-Check: The click-check can be adjusted by simply turning the
regulator button on the face of the frame: clockwise to increase the check;
anti-clockwise to decrease the check. When the reel is not in use, the check
should be turned to the minimum setting.

Jim Hardy: James Hardy was the last member of the
Hardy dynasty to work for the company that his grandfather had founded. Born in
Alnwick in 1927, Jim started fishing at the age of 7 and became a very successful
angler, winning no less than 38 British and world casting championship titles.
After an apprenticeship at Vickers-Armstrong, he joined the
company in the early 1950’s and was appointed works director in 1959, leading the
firm’s search to develop new materials – a quest which resulted in Hardy’s
pioneering range of carbon fibre rods. Jim was also responsible for the reel
development and introduced one of the firm’s most famous products, the Marquis
range, in 1970.
After the takeover by the Harris and Sheldon Group, he took
on the role of Marketing Manager and toured the world promoting Hardy products,
during a period in which the company won numerous design awards. He retired in
1992 and remained a consultant for the Company until his death.
